在数学建模中,汽车路径规划问题是一个典型的优化问题,涉及到多方面的数学理论与实际应用。这个问题的主要目标是设计一个算法或模型,使得汽车能够从起点到终点以最短的时间、最少的燃料消耗或者最优化的其他指标行驶。在这个过程中,我们需要考虑多种因素,如道路网络、交通规则、交通流量、地形地貌等。 我们要了解路径规划的基本方法。最常用的是Dijkstra算法,这是一种解决最短路径问题的经典算法。它通过逐步扩展最短路径树来找到起点到所有其他点的最短路径。然而,对于大规模的交通网络,Dijkstra算法的效率较低,因此我们可能需要使用A*搜索算法,它引入了启发式函数来指导搜索,从而大幅减少了计算量。 接下来,我们要引入图论的概念。道路网络可以抽象为一个加权图,其中节点表示交叉路口,边表示路段,权重则代表路段的长度或者其他成本(如时间、油耗)。通过在图上寻找最短路径,我们可以找到汽车的理想行驶路线。 在处理实时交通信息时,动态规划是另一种重要的工具。通过收集实时交通数据,我们可以不断更新图的权重,反映当前的路况。这样,规划的路径就能适应变化的环境,避免拥堵路段。 此外,线性规划和整数规划在解决路径规划问题中也有应用。例如,我们可以设置约束条件,如限制每条路的最大通行车辆数,然后通过优化目标函数(最小化时间或成本)来寻找最优解。有时,问题会涉及到离散决策,这时整数规划就显得尤为重要。 在实际应用中,我们还需要考虑地形因素对汽车性能的影响。例如,上坡会增加能耗,下坡则可能带来节省。这需要引入非线性模型,通过调整权重来体现地形对路径选择的影响。 在“数学建模的心得以汽车路径规划问题.pdf”中,可能会详细阐述这些数学方法如何应用于实际问题,并给出具体的建模步骤和实例分析。而“说明.pdf”可能是对建模过程的补充解释,包括可能遇到的难点、解决方案以及模型的局限性。 数学建模在汽车路径规划问题中的应用是一门综合性的学科,涵盖了图论、搜索算法、优化理论以及实时数据分析等多个领域。通过深入学习和实践,我们可以设计出更加智能和高效的路径规划策略,服务于现代交通系统。
- 粉丝: 3548
- 资源: 596
- 我的内容管理 展开
- 我的资源 快来上传第一个资源
- 我的收益 登录查看自己的收益
- 我的积分 登录查看自己的积分
- 我的C币 登录后查看C币余额
- 我的收藏
- 我的下载
- 下载帮助
最新资源
- Python+html实现抖音创作者数据分析(离线+实时)
- (源码)基于Spring Boot和Vue的在线云办公系统.zip
- (源码)基于Python和PyQt框架的文件管理系统模拟.zip
- (源码)基于Spring Boot和Vue的培训学院管理系统.zip
- 园区网络设计与配置实现全网互通
- (源码)基于ESP8266和MQTT的智能LED灯带控制系统.zip
- 基于Java语言的Age客栈项目设计源码
- 基于Jupyter扩展的jupylet-cn项目中文翻译设计源码
- 基于Java语言的校园跳蚤市场后台管理系统设计源码
- 基于Jupyter Notebook的PYTHON项目——周某年度最骄傲之作:零挂科挑战成功设计源码